TAPPI T 519 om-17 provides a measure of diffuse opacity (paper backing) of white and near-white papers,
previously known as "printing opacity."
The method may be employed for colored papers on condition that their reflectance (paper backing) is
greater than 20% and their diffuse opacity (paper backing) is greater than 45% (1).
The method is not suitable for highly transparent papers such as glassine.
This method employs d/0 geometry, illuminant C, and paper backing whereas TAPPI T 425 "Opacity of
Paper" employs 15/d geometry, illuminant A, both 89% reflectance backing and paper backing.
This method is similar to ISO 2471.
